We will only use a towncar service in the future. Mears from MCO wasn't too bad(sure), we waited 30 minutes for a van that stopped at 3 other hotels before we were dropped off at our resort. On the return to MCO we boarded a bus 3 hours and 40 minutes before our plane was to leave. we had no additional stops and were at the airport over 3 hours before our flight at the opposite end of the airport from our check in counter. Both ways was a terriable waste of time, a limo service would have picked us up when we wanted and dropped us off at the right terminal.......spruce

When we were Disney newbies, we used Mears because that's who they sent discount coupons for. We didn't realize there way any other way...we thought stopping at multiple hotels was the norm. Then one day we were intercepted by Transtar while heading to the Mears counter...they offered to honor our coupon and said they had a van leaving that had our hotel as the first stop. Better, but still not ideal. Then we finally discovered the wonderful world of towncars (we are too lazy to rent a car). Now we use Happy Limo for our MCO to WDW and MCO to Port Canaveral runs. Mears was good for going from WDW to Universal/IOA tho'. We left early enough on those runs so that we didn't mind stopping at other hotels, and by the end of a long day at Universal, we are too tired to care!

We used Mears last July. It was the worst service I have ever seen. We had a group of 16 so we were on a bus. I had to tell the bus driver how to get from the airport to Beach Club. On the way back to the airport, the bus driver tore my suitcase. They did nothing about our complaints. We will never use them again.
 
We used Mears last January, because our traveling friends wanted to. :rolleyes: fine.
The driving service was not bad. We really didn't wait long and there was one other stop at a resort going to CSR.
Leaving was worse, with longer and more stops. Very full load when we were done. But we arrived at MCO in plenty of time.
My main complaint is they were not helpful in any manner. And I don't think any of them could have smiled. (They must just LOVE their jobs.) And trying to get any information from them was hard. People of few words. You better know half of the answer already if you are asking them a question.
At least they got us there and back.
